I had a TH400 with a 3.55 rear gear and got about 12mpg. Changed to a BTO lev2 and now I get about 17mpg. Of coyurse that is highway driving, I have no Idea what the difference is running around town with this lead foot. trans swap

Originally Posted by SIXFOOTER
you can buy it and install it yourself, no majick, it bolts right in no driveshaft changes needed, but needs a new cross member.
if your vette came w/a th400 u can use the stock crossmember, u might have to notch it to get to the rear oil pan bolt, i had to but others didn't. u have to change the yoke & universal to the 200r4

Had small block and automatic with 3.08 gears, never got over 13mpg.
Put in 700r BTO stage 2 and still get 13mpg if I never get out of town but all highway driving I can get 22mpg .
BTO was very helpful on the install I did myself. Had trouble at first, tranny would not shift into 4th. BTO trouble shot over the phone and backed up their product by sending me a new valve body which took care of the problem. Did not have to send trans. back to California for warranty
